Can you get a Turbo S without the Yellow Calipers??
Sorry Guys Ive searched and cant find the answer. I can't change the colour for the configurator.
I might be able to swap my 18 TT for a 19 TTS. Need to finish a build but I hate the yellow Calipers - They look horrible with Red interior |
Assuming it's not on the configurator, you can contact Porsche exclusive and work through them to have it done at the factory. If you do this, expect to pay quite a fee. Alternatively your dealer can probably arrange to have them painted for you before delivery.

Plenty of companies offer powder coating of any color for calipers, just make sure they replace the seals, most high end shops that do this include this service, had it done on several Corvette's
